Validity of SCN issued u/s 73 of CGST Act challenged - recovery ...


Validity of GST demand notice challenged for licensing services on minerals from 1/7/17 to 31/12/18. HC issued notice, no coercive recovery.

August 12, 2024

Case Laws     GST     HC

Validity of SCN issued u/s 73 of CGST Act challenged - recovery of demand of differential tax for tax period from 1-7-2017 to 31-12-2018 - transactions related to licensing services for right to use minerals including exploration and evaluation under Service Code 9973 37 - retrospective operation of CBIC circular dated 6-10-2021 - High Court issued notice to Opposite Parties - directed no coercive action for recovery of demand till next date of hearing - matter listed along with related writ petition.
